Hazel Strachan Obituary

STRACHAN-Hazel Jean (Woodcock) Of Webster, NY, formerly of Lewiston, NY, died on November 22, 2007, at age 76 after a long battle with breast cancer. Predeceased by her husband, John N. "Jack" Strachan Jr., MD. Hazel is survived by two 2 brothers, Richard (Diane) Woodcock of Youngstown and Stanley (Carol) Woodcock of North Tonawanda; four children, Ann Strachan (John "Ax" Gebhardt) of Rochester, Catherine Strachan-Dunning (Jim Dunning) of Ashburn, VA, John (Mary Ann) Strachan III of Boynton Beach, FL, and Margaret (Michael) Williams of Penfield; three grandchildren, Colin Dunning of Los Angeles, CA, Robert and Jack Williams of Penfield. Hazel graduated from the E.J. Meyer Memorial Hospital School of Nursing in 1951, and married Jack in 1955. After living in Niagara Falls for a number of years, they moved to Lewiston in 1964, their home for over 40 years. Friends are invited to join a memorial celebration from 12-3 PM Wednesday, November 28 at Water Street Landing, 115 S. Water St., Lewiston, NY.
